My Buying Guides on Canada Dry Ginger Ale Expiration
What I Look for Before Buying Canada Dry Ginger Ale
When I buy Canada Dry Ginger Ale, the first thing I check is the expiration or best-by date on the can, bottle, or packaging. I always look for the freshest stock possible because I want the best taste and carbonation. If I’m buying in bulk, I make sure the dates are far enough out that I can finish them before the flavor starts to fade.
How I Check the Date on the Package
I usually inspect the bottom of cans, the neck or cap of bottles, and the outer carton for printed date codes. Sometimes the date is easy to read, and sometimes it takes a closer look. If I can’t find a clear date, I ask the store staff before I buy. That saves me from bringing home soda that may have been sitting too long.
What Expiration Means to Me
From my experience, an expiration or best-by date on ginger ale is more about quality than safety. I’ve noticed that Canada Dry Ginger Ale can still be drinkable after the date, but the fizz, flavor, and sweetness may not be as good. I prefer to buy it well before that date so I get the crisp taste I expect.
How I Store It After Buying
Once I bring it home, I store Canada Dry Ginger Ale in a cool, dry place away from sunlight. If I want it to last longer, I keep unopened cans or bottles in the pantry or refrigerator. After opening, I always refrigerate it and try to finish it quickly because the carbonation disappears faster once it’s exposed to air.
Signs I Watch for Before Drinking
Even if the date looks fine, I still check the drink before I sip it. I look for a flat taste, strange smell, or unusual color. If the bottle is damaged, leaking, or the can is swollen, I do not drink it. My rule is simple: if anything seems off, I throw it out.
Buying in Bulk: What I Consider
When I buy a multi-pack or case, I make sure I have enough storage space and that I’ll use it before the best-by date. I avoid buying too much at once if I know I won’t drink it quickly. For me, bulk buying only makes sense when the dates are fresh and the price is worth it.
My Final Buying Tip
My best advice is to check the date, inspect the packaging, and buy from stores with good product turnover. That way, I get the freshest Canada Dry Ginger Ale with the best taste and fizz. If I’m careful before I buy, I’m much more likely to enjoy it the way it’s meant to taste.
